| Title | Letter; T. Wright Vaughan, Knightsbridge, to 7th Earl of Sandwich. |
| Description | The Earl's view of Mr. Fletcher's application is the correct one. Will tell Fletcher that the Regiment is full. Hopes that it will indeed be full. Lord Robert will be a good example to those who ought to come forward in that service. Thinks that the Earl's plan for the 2nd Company is well thought of and also both feasible and humane for Browne, who will thus be able to continue to receive his 2/6d and also in accord with the Act. |
| Date | 2nd February, 1846 |
